They only had 4 different colors to choose from (you can see a full selection here) so I stood there debating for as long as I thought it would take Hubby to run across the store for ice cream and finally settled on "silver sparkle".  Mostly because the metallic filament was multi colored and that seemed more like a Party!!!


I will say that I had a few moments of frustration as I found the metallic filament separating from the yarn and tangling around my hook.   I also discovered that when it became entagled it would get buggered up and not lay flat, but if I stretched out the stitch on my hook it would re-wind itself and look just like new!! I eventually got  in the groove and my stitching smoothed out. And as always, Caron Simply Soft really comes through in the soft department.  I was not disappointed!!
